Su Hongzhen had no sect affiliation; he was a rogue cultivator.

The reason he was able to burst onto the scene and obtain the qualification for the Heavenly Summit Mountain Dao Inquiry eight thousand years ago was because he had received an invitation from the Mirage Palace that year.

Although Su Hongzhen’s status was that of a rogue cultivator, his relationship with the Mirage Palace was quite close.

This was because he was on very good terms with the Dao Sect Wanderer of the Mirage Palace at that time.

It was precisely because of this that after Su Hongzhen reached the summit at the Heavenly Summit Mountain Dao Inquiry, he wasn’t viewed as a thorn in people’s side.

Later, that Mirage Palace Dao Sect Wanderer unfortunately perished while campaigning against a Great Demon of the Dao Union Realm at the ninth stage.

From then on, the relationship between Su Hongzhen and the Mirage Palace gradually cooled.

Until they became complete strangers.

However, by that time, Su Hongzhen was already a cultivator at the late Divine Ability Realm, getting closer and closer to the Dao Union Realm.

There were almost no people left who had the capability and the qualifications to hinder his rise.
